Bloomberg Law::
An American judge grants a permanent injunction against an Ohio law which required that platforms verify that users are at least 16 years old and seek parents’ consent for young users– A federal judge has canceled the Ohio law limiting the use of adolescent social media, marking another legal victory for the technology industry group …
